64-Gd-156 NEA RCOM-JUN82 E.MENAPACE ET.AL.
JEF/DOC- 8 DIST-MAY05 REV1-MAY05 20050504
----JEFF-31 MATERIAL 6437
-----INCIDENT NEUTRON DATA
------ENDF-6 FORMAT
***************************** JEFF-3.1 *************************
** **
** Original data taken from: JEFF-3.0 **
** **
******************************************************************
***************************** JEFF-3.0 ***********************
DATA TAKEN FROM :- JEF-2.2 (DIST-JAN92)
******************************************************************
* JEF-2 *
* DATA WERE TAKEN FROM ENEA/CEA EVALUATION *
******************************************************************
* 16-FEB-85: DATA EXTENDED UP TO 20 MEV.
* 27-APR-89: MISSING CHARGE PARTICLE PRODUCTION DATA INCLUDED
* FROM REAC-ECN-4 LIBRARY
* 15-DEC-91: ISOTOPE MASS CORRECTED (H. TELLIER)
******************************************************************
COMPILATION
-----------
1) RESONANCE FORMULA WAS CHANGED FROM THE SINGLE-LEVEL BREIT-
WIGNER TO THE MULTI-LEVEL BREIT-WIGNER TO AVOID NEGATIVE VLUES OF
ELASTIC SCATTERING CROSS SECTION, AND THE BACKGROUND CROSS SEC-
TION FOR THE ELASTIC SCATTERING WAS REPLACED WITH ZERO.
2) Q-VALUES AND THRESHOLD ENERGIES WERE MODIFIED.
3) THE TOTAL AND TOTAL INELASTIC SCATTERING CROSS SECTIONS WERE
RE-CALCULATED FROM PARTIAL CROSS SECTIONS.
ENEA EVAL-OCT76 CNEN-CDC-BOLOGNA
-----------------------------MF 1-------------------------------
MT 451
2200 M/SEC CAPTURE 1.35B
RESONANCE INTEGRAL 100.B
-----------------------------MF 2------------------------------
MT 151
CONTAINS RESOLVED PLUS UNRESOLVED MEAN PARAMETERS
-----------------------------MF 3-------------------------------
MT 1,2 AND 102
A SMOOTH BACKGROUND WAS ADDED TO ACCOUNT FOR NEGATIVE PEACKS
MT 251,252,253
COMPUTED BY SYSMF FROM CERBERO ANGULAR DISTRIBUTIONS.
-----------------------------MF 4-------------------------------
MT 2
TRANSFORMATION MATRIX AND LEGENDRE COEFFICIENTS COMPUTED BY
SYSMF FROM THE ANGULAR DISTRIBUTIONS GENERATED BY CERBERO.
MT 16
ASSUMED ISOTROPIC IN THE LABORATORY FRAME OF REFERENCE
MT 91 AND DISCRETE LEVELS
ASSUMED ISOTROPIC IN THE LABORATORY FRAME OF REFERENCE
-----------------------------MF 5-------------------------------
MT 16
EVAPORATION SPECTRUM (LF=9) ASSUMED, WITH T=T(E) AND
T = CONSTANT FOR THE 2ND NEUTRON
MT 91
EVAPORATION SPECTRUM (LF=9) ASSUMED, WITH T=T(E)
----------------------------------------------------------------
COMPUTER CODES USED WERE
1)-CRESO RESONANCE REGION DATA
2)-CERBERO CONTINUUM REGION CROSS SECTION,ANGULAR AND ENERGY
DISTRIBUTION DATA
3)-ERINNI HIGH ENERGY REGION CROSS SECTIONS
4)-SYSMF DATA HANDLING AND FILE GENERATION
COMPLETED ON TUESDAY 26 OCTOBER 1976 AT 20.34.14
***************** PROGRAM LINEAR (VERSION 83-1) *****************
DATA LINEARIZED TO WITHIN AN ACCURACY OF 0.100 PER-CENT
